site stats

Sas proc sql where date greater than

Webbthe DATA step, PROC SQL comparison operators, mnemonics, and their descriptions appear in the following table. SAS Operator Mnemonic Operators Description = EQ Equal … Webb27 jan. 2024 · Where date is a SAS date value that is specified either as a variable or as a SAS date constant. Example DATA sample; SET sample; days = DAY (DOB); RUN; Here the DAY function extracts the day value from the date variable DOB and saves it in the new numeric variable days. WEEKDAY Function

SAS PROC SQL Date Comparison - Data Management - The …

WebbSQL procedure is more efficient because: 1. No new transitional data set(s) need to be created. Thus, data sets do not need to be sorted, which saves resources. 2. Program is shorter. In the first example, two SORT procedures, one DATA step and one PRINT procedure are used compared to only one SQL procedure. WebbPROC SQL is a SAS Procedure that combines the functionality of DATA and PROC steps into a single step. PROC SQL can sort data, create summaries of data, subsetting, join (merge), concatenate datasets, create new or calculated variables, print the results, create a new table, or view all in a single step. PROC SQL in SAS can be used to retrieve ... in a similar fashion as above one can https://zambezihunters.com

SAS Tutorials: Date-Time Functions and Variables in SAS

WebbA SAS operator is a symbol that represents a comparison, arithmetic calculation, or logical operation; a SAS function; or grouping parentheses. SAS uses two major types of … WebbA WHERE expression can be a SAS function, or it can be a sequence of operands and operators that define a condition for selecting observations. In general, the syntax of a … WebbTo select observations from individual data sets when a SET, MERGE, MODIFY, or UPDATE statement specifies more than one data set, apply a WHERE= data set option to each … in a silent way davis

SAS Help Center

Category:SAS - SQL - tutorialspoint.com

Tags:Sas proc sql where date greater than

Sas proc sql where date greater than

SAS Greater Than or Equal to with GE or >= - The Programming …

Webb5 jan. 2024 · The Base SAS WHERE processor handles truncated comparisons differently than PROC SQL does. The Base SAS WHERE processor truncates comparisons based on the actual length of a string, even if a string includes blanks at the end. PROC SQL trims trailing blanks from the string values before it truncates comparisons. Webb14 juni 2012 · proc sql; SELECT COUNT (*) FROM BNA_BASE.base_agent_bna_cust_date WHERE bna_outcome_ts >= '04Jun12:00:00:00'd AND bna_outcome_ts < …

Sas proc sql where date greater than

Did you know?

Webb19 jan. 2006 · When comparing Dates on SAS, you should convert Datetime formats, e.g., '01DEC2005:00:00:00' to date formats that SAS understand, using the function Datepart: … Webb10 mars 2024 · Valid in: DATA step or PROC step: Categories: Action: CAS: Type: Declarative: Note: Using a random number function in a WHERE statement might generate a different result set from using a random number function in a subsetting IF statement.

Webb10 mars 2024 · The Base SAS Procedures Guide documents the action of the WHERE statement only in those procedures for which you can specify more than one data set. In … WebbIn SAS, you can use a WHERE expression in the following situations: WHERE statement in both DATA and PROC steps. For example, the following PRINT procedure includes a WHERE statement so that only the observations where the year is greater than 2001 are printed: proc print data=employees; where startdate > '01jan2001'd; run; WHERE= data …

WebbIn SAS, you can use a WHERE expression in the following situations: WHERE statement in both DATA and PROC steps. For example, the following PRINT procedure includes a … WebbHi, in my proc sql statement, I want to apply a where condition on the date variable. The date variable has datetime20. format, for example: 17APR2016:07:57:23 My code is …

Webb20 apr. 2024 · The SAS greater than or equal to operators GEand >=operators allow us to check if a variable is greater than or equal to another value in a SAS data step. Below is …

WebbThe basic syntax for using PROC SQL in SAS is −. PROC SQL; SELECT Columns FROM TABLE WHERE Columns GROUP BY Columns ; QUIT; Following is the description of the parameters used −. The SQL query is … in a similar manner asWebbPROC SQL sets the column width at n and specifies that character columns longer than n are flowed to multiple lines. When you specify FLOW= n m, PROC SQL floats the width of the columns between these limits to achieve a balanced layout. Specifying FLOW without arguments is equivalent to specifying FLOW=12 200. Default NOFLOW INOBS= n inani prop holdings pty ltdWebb27 jan. 2024 · SAS date values are the stored internally as the number of days between January 1, 1960, and a specified date. Dates after January 1, 1960, are stored as positive … inani beach resort \u0026 spaWebbSAS® 9.4 SQL Procedure User’s Guide, Fourth Edition documentation.sas.com. SAS® Help Center. Customer Support SAS Documentation. SAS® 9.4 and SAS® Viya® 3.5 Programming Documentation SAS 9.4 / Viya 3.5. PDF EPUB Feedback. Welcome to SAS Programming Documentation for SAS® 9 ... inani beach cox\\u0027s bazar bangladeshinani beach resort \\u0026 spaWebb20 aug. 2024 · 1 You can use INTCK () to get the number of days between today () and Birth_Date column. Code proc sql; create table myTable as select Birth_Date, intck ('day', … in a similar manner as or toWebbPROC SQL can be used to produce a single aggregate value by summarizing data down rows. The advantage of using a summary function in PROC SQL is that it generally computes the aggregate quicker than if a user-defined equation were constructed, and it reduces the amount of program testing. inani beach cox\\u0027s bazar